I am persuaded that woman is not to be, as she has been, a mere second-hand agent in the regeneration of a fallen world, but the acknowledged equal and co-worker with man in this glorious work.
Said by
Archibald Henry Grimké

Editor's note · Context

Grimké advocates for women's active participation and equality in societal reform efforts.
